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of natural gas ammonia production technology, and in particular to a carbon dioxide removal device for ammonia synthesis. Background Technology

[0002] The process of synthesizing ammonia from natural gas mainly includes steps such as desulfurization, secondary conversion, carbon monoxide shift reaction, carbon dioxide removal, and methanation. In existing technologies, benzil solution is primarily used for carbon dioxide removal. Benzil solution decarbonization is a method of purifying gas by adding diethanolamine as an activator to a hot potassium carbonate solution.

[0003] However, in the actual decarbonization process, as the benzyl solution continues to be decarbonized, the benzyl solution that has absorbed carbon dioxide (called rich solution) will have some solid impurities, such as sulfur powder (part of the hydrogen sulfide in natural gas reacts with the rust after equipment corrosion), rust, etc. These impurities will cause the rich solution to foam easily and produce liquid blockage, which will seriously affect the subsequent decarbonization effect. Utility Model Content

[0004] The purpose of this invention is to provide a carbon dioxide removal device for ammonia synthesis, so as to at least effectively remove solid impurities from rich liquid.

[0005] The objective of this utility model is achieved through the following technical solution:

[0006] A carbon dioxide removal device for ammonia synthesis includes an absorption tower body, a first outlet pipe disposed at the bottom end of the absorption tower body, and a filter assembly disposed at the outlet end of the first outlet pipe. The filter assembly includes a filter box, a filter barrel disposed within the filter box, a distribution plate disposed within the filter barrel, multiple distribution holes disposed on the bottom and side walls of the distribution plate, a rotating pipe disposed on the top wall of the distribution plate with its top end rotatably penetrating through the top wall of the filter barrel and the top wall of the filter box and connected to a rotating assembly disposed outside the filter box, and a second outlet pipe disposed on the side wall of the filter box. The outlet end of the first outlet pipe is disposed within the rotating pipe and rotatably connected to the rotating pipe.

[0007] Preferably, the rotating assembly includes a first bevel gear sleeved on the rotating tube, a second bevel gear meshing with the first bevel gear, a rotating shaft connected to the center of the second bevel gear, and a motor disposed at the top of the filter box and fixedly connected to the end of the rotating shaft away from the second bevel gear.

[0008] Preferably, the rotating assembly further includes a retaining ring sleeved on the rotating tube via a bearing, and a retaining rod connecting the retaining ring and the top wall of the filter box.

[0009] Preferably, the filter box includes a box body and a box cover detachably disposed on the top of the box body; the filter bucket includes a bucket body and a bucket cover detachably disposed on the top of the bucket body, and the bucket cover and the box cover are detachably connected.

[0010] Preferably, the top of the bucket lid is provided with an L-shaped connecting plate, and the L-shaped connecting plate and the lid are connected by bolts.

[0011] Preferably, the barrel body and the barrel lid are threaded together.

[0012] Preferably, the liquid distribution plate and the rotating tube are threaded together.

[0013] Preferably, the inner wall of the filter box is provided with a plurality of support blocks that contact the bottom end of the filter barrel.

[0014]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ial effects of this utility model are as follows:

[0015] By setting up a filter box, a filter barrel is installed inside the filter box, and a distribution plate connected to the first outlet pipe is installed inside the filter barrel; the decarbonized rich liquid can be introduced into the distribution plate along the first outlet pipe. After being separated by the distribution plate, the rich liquid can flow more evenly into the filter barrel, ensuring that the filtration is more balanced throughout the filter barrel. This avoids the technical problems of severe uneven filtration and low filtration efficiency that occur when the distribution plate is not used, where the rich liquid flows along the first outlet pipe to a certain point in the filter barrel.

[0016] By installing a rotating tube on the top wall of the separating plate, which rotates sequentially through the top wall of the filter bucket and the top wall of the filter box and is connected to a rotating assembly located outside the filter box, and by rotating the first outlet pipe to the rotating tube, the rotating assembly can drive the rotating tube to rotate in the first outlet pipe during the separating process, thereby causing the separating plate connected to the rotating tube to rotate accordingly. Through the action of centrifugal force, the discharge efficiency of the rich liquid in the separating plate can be significantly improved, further improving the filtration efficiency.

[0017] Through the synergistic effect of the above devices, solid impurities such as sulfur powder and rust in the rich solution can be removed before regeneration, thereby effectively improving the purity of the lean or semi-lean solution obtained after regeneration, improving its decarbonization efficiency, reducing the foaming degree of the rich solution formed after the lean or semi-lean solution is decarbonized again, and effectively alleviating the problem of liquid blockage. Detailed Implementation

[0022] Example 1

[0023] A carbon dioxide removal device for ammonia synthesis includes an absorption tower body 1, a first outlet pipe 2 disposed at the bottom of the absorption tower body 1, and a filter assembly disposed at the outlet end of the first outlet pipe 2. The filter assembly includes a filter box 3, a filter barrel 4 disposed within the filter box 3 (the side walls and bottom walls of the filter barrel 4 are provided with multiple filter holes), a distribution plate 5 disposed within the filter barrel 4, multiple distribution holes disposed on the bottom wall and side walls of the distribution plate 5, a rotating pipe 6 disposed on the top wall of the distribution plate 5 and whose top end rotatably penetrates the top wall of the filter barrel 4 and the top wall of the filter box 3 and is connected to a rotating assembly disposed outside the filter box 3, and a second outlet pipe 7 disposed on the side wall of the filter box 3. The outlet end of the first outlet pipe 2 is disposed within the rotating pipe 6 and is rotatably connected to the rotating pipe 6.

[0024] The absorption tower body 1 adopts existing technology, that is, it includes the absorption tower and the components installed therein, such as a lean liquid spray section at the top of the absorption tower, a semi-lean liquid spray assembly in the middle of the absorption tower, and a defoamer, an anti-vortex baffle, and a gas distributor at the bottom of the absorption tower. That is, all the components inside the absorption tower adopt existing technology, and this utility model does not make any improvements to them.

[0025] Furthermore, such as Figure 1 As shown, the rotating assembly includes a first bevel gear 8 sleeved on the rotating tube 6, a second bevel gear 9 meshing with the first bevel gear 8, a rotating shaft 10 connected to the center of the second bevel gear 9, and a motor 11 disposed at the top of the filter box 3 and fixedly connected to the end of the rotating shaft 10 away from the second bevel gear 9. Further, as... Figure 1 As shown, the rotating assembly also includes a fixing ring 12 sleeved on the rotating tube 6 via a bearing, and a fixing rod 13 connecting the fixing ring 12 and the top wall of the filter box 3.

[0026] Working principle: Natural gas is introduced through the inlet pipe at the bottom of the absorption tower body 1. After being distributed by the gas distributor at the bottom of the absorption tower, it comes into countercurrent contact with the lean liquid from the top of the tower and the semi-lean liquid from the middle of the tower, completing the decarbonization reaction in the absorption tower. The resulting rich liquid is discharged from the first outlet pipe 2 of the absorption tower to the filter box 3. Specifically, a water pump can be installed on the first outlet pipe 2. The rich liquid flows into the separating plate 5 along the first outlet pipe 2, and then is sprayed onto the side wall and bottom wall of the filter box 4 through multiple separating holes in the separating plate 5. It is then filtered by the side wall and bottom wall of the filter box 4, retaining solid impurities such as sulfur and rust inside the filter box 4, thus achieving solid-liquid separation.

[0027] During the filtration process, to improve filtration efficiency, motor 11 needs to be turned on. Under the action of motor 11, the rotating shaft 10 drives the second bevel gear 9 to rotate. The second bevel gear 9 drives the first bevel gear 8, which meshes with it, to rotate. This, in turn, drives the rotating tube 6 and the separating plate 5 connected to the rotating tube 6 to rotate. During the rotation, the rich liquid in the separating plate 5 can quickly pass through the separating holes of the separating plate 5 under the action of centrifugal force, and the rich liquid discharged through the separating holes is quickly thrown towards the side wall and bottom wall of the filter barrel 4, improving filtration efficiency. The filtered rich liquid is discharged through the second outlet pipe 7 and enters the regeneration process.

[0028] Through the synergistic effect of the above devices, solid impurities such as sulfur powder and rust in the rich solution can be removed before regeneration, thereby effectively improving the purity of the lean or semi-lean solution obtained after regeneration, improving its decarbonization efficiency, reducing the foaming degree of the rich solution formed after the lean or semi-lean solution is decarbonized again, and effectively alleviating the problem of liquid blockage.

[0029] Example 2

[0030] Based on Example 1, such as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, the filter box 3 includes a box body 301 and a detachable cover 302 detachably mounted on the top of the box body 301 (the box body 301 and the cover 302 can be connected by bolts 16), so that the components inside the box body 301 or the components on the cover 302 can be repaired or cleaned after the cover 302 is opened. The filter bucket 4 includes a bucket body 401 and a detachable cover 402 detachably mounted on the top of the bucket body 401, and the cover 402 and the box cover 302 are detachably connected. Further, the bucket body 401 and the cover 402 are threaded together. When it is necessary to clean solid impurities inside the bucket body 401, the cover 302 is opened, and then the bucket body 401 is rotated to disassemble the bucket body 401 and the cover 402, thus completing the cleaning, repair or replacement of the bucket body 401. Further, as Figure 2As shown, an L-shaped connecting plate 14 is provided at the top of the barrel cover 402. The L-shaped connecting plate 14 and the box cover 302 are connected by bolts 16. This arrangement allows the filter barrel 4 to be installed inside the filter box 3, improving the convenience of disassembly and installation. Furthermore, the distributing plate 5 and the rotating tube 6 are threadedly connected. After the barrel body 401 is removed from the barrel cover 402, the distributing plate 5 can be directly rotated to separate it from the rotating tube 6, facilitating maintenance and replacement of the distributing plate 5. Further, as...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, the inner wall of the filter box 3 is provided with a plurality of support blocks 15 that contact the bottom end of the filter barrel 4 to support the filter barrel 4 and share the load of the L-shaped connecting block.
